Output f2712876c664a5607c1a3fdc698d87fed7d4db73cc3c6e3bcdfbb841583b2c9c:17

value
2923138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a1df96ba00f02034128a1a6356bc25c2b041cba OP_EQUAL
address
35XiDFXy3ftKZPEpubfcYuPB3hjZB21oDh
transaction
f2712876c664a5607c1a3fdc698d87fed7d4db73cc3c6e3bcdfbb841583b2c9c
confirmations
426680
spent
true

1 Sat Range